Animal Crossing: Wild World is the follow-up to Animal Crossing game for the GameCube.

Animal Crossing: Wild World doesn’t really have an objective like other games. Your main task is to live. There are a number of milestones along the way such as paying off mortgages, getting a bigger house and making new friends.

There are a number of things to do each day, from finding fossils and pulling weeds to watering flowers and nursing sick friends back to health. The addition of the Nintendo Wi-Fi Connection allows real-world friends to visit your town, you can chat and send letters to each other or play games like Hide and Seek.

Beginning Your New Life

You start in a taxi driven by the classic Kapp'n. You have a conversation with him that determines how you look and where your house is located. You start by working for Tom Nook, basicaly a tutorial. This includes sending letters, talking to animals, planting flowers etc. Once you are done you are a free human.
